When Editorial Meets Playful: Athina & Ilyich’s Engagement Session at Pasadena City Hall
Athina and Ilyich reached out for their engagement session in late October, excited to include their two dogs in the photos. They wanted something that felt personal and true to them, a mix of elegant portraits and candid moments that show their real chemistry.
We started the shoot at the front of Pasadena City Hall, where the soft afternoon light hit the arches beautifully. I always like to begin with a few warm-up photos to help couples ease into the session, letting them move naturally, laugh, and settle into the rhythm. Soon after, we focused on a few intimate moments, quiet kisses, shared smiles, and playful walks that brought out their connection effortlessly.
Throughout the session, I leaned into shadows, silhouettes, and movement, elements I love using to tell a story without needing eye contact with the camera. Rather than posing perfectly, I encouraged Athina and Ilyich to simply enjoy the time together, talk about dinner plans, play with their dogs, or wander through the courtyard as if they were on a date.
The result was a blend of classic and editorial engagement photos that still felt warm and personal. The presence of their dogs added a genuine, family-like energy that made the shoot even more special. Between the refined architecture of Pasadena City Hall and the laughter they shared, the day became a perfect reflection of their relationship, sophisticated, playful, and full of love.

I’ve always loved framing my couples within their surroundings. Many of my favorite shots aren’t close-ups but wide compositions that blend people and place together. I like using the environment as a soft foreground, letting architecture, light, or movement lead the eye toward the couple. It’s a bit like watching a scene unfold in a movie, where the atmosphere tells as much of the story as the subjects themselves.
When they brought their dogs into the frame, the whole session took on a different rhythm. Everything felt more relaxed, almost like a real date instead of a photoshoot. They laughed, played, and walked together through the courtyard, and those moments brought a beautiful sense of warmth and authenticity to the photos.
